#include <MidiController.h>
|
| | MidiController (Model *_parent) |
| | ~MidiController () override=default |
| void | processInEvent (const MidiEvent &_me, const TimePos &_time, f_cnt_t offset=0) override |
| void | processOutEvent (const MidiEvent &_me, const TimePos &_time, f_cnt_t offset=0) override |
| void | saveSettings (QDomDocument &_doc, QDomElement &_this) override |
| void | loadSettings (const QDomElement &_this) override |
| QString | nodeName () const override |
| void | subscribeReadablePorts (const MidiPort::Map &_map) |
| | Controller (ControllerType _type, Model *_parent, const QString &_display_name) |
| | ~Controller () override |
| virtual float | currentValue (int _offset) |
| virtual ValueBuffer * | valueBuffer () |
| bool | isSampleExact () const |
| void | setSampleExact (bool _exact) |
| ControllerType | type () const |
| bool | frequentUpdates () const |
| virtual const QString & | name () const |
| void | addConnection (ControllerConnection *) |
| void | removeConnection (ControllerConnection *) |
| int | connectionCount () const |
| bool | hasModel (const Model *m) const |
| | Model (Model *parent, QString displayName=QString(), bool defaultConstructed=false) |
| | ~Model () override=default |
| bool | isDefaultConstructed () const |
| Model * | parentModel () const |
| virtual QString | displayName () const |
| virtual void | setDisplayName (const QString &displayName) |
| virtual QString | fullDisplayName () const |
| | JournallingObject () |
| | ~JournallingObject () override |
| jo_id_t | id () const |
| void | saveJournallingState (const bool newState) |
| void | restoreJournallingState () |
| void | addJournalCheckPoint () |
| QDomElement | saveState (QDomDocument &_doc, QDomElement &_parent) override |
| void | restoreState (const QDomElement &_this) override |
| bool | isJournalling () const |
| void | setJournalling (const bool _sr) |
| bool | testAndSetJournalling (const bool newState) |
| bool | isJournallingStateStackEmpty () const |
| | SerializingObject () |
| virtual | ~SerializingObject () |
| void | setHook (SerializingObjectHook *_hook) |
| SerializingObjectHook * | hook () |
| | MidiEventProcessor ()=default |
| virtual | ~MidiEventProcessor ()=default |
◆ MidiController()
| lmms::MidiController::MidiController |
( |
Model * | _parent | ) |
|
◆ ~MidiController()
| lmms::MidiController::~MidiController |
( |
| ) |
|
|
overridedefault |
◆ createDialog
◆ loadSettings()
| void lmms::MidiController::loadSettings |
( |
const QDomElement & | _this | ) |
|
|
overridevirtual |
◆ nodeName()
| QString lmms::MidiController::nodeName |
( |
void | | ) |
const |
|
overridevirtual |
◆ processInEvent()
◆ processOutEvent()
◆ saveSettings()
| void lmms::MidiController::saveSettings |
( |
QDomDocument & | _doc, |
|
|
QDomElement & | _this ) |
|
overridevirtual |
◆ subscribeReadablePorts()
◆ updateName
| void lmms::MidiController::updateName |
( |
| ) |
|
|
slot |
◆ updateValueBuffer()
| void lmms::MidiController::updateValueBuffer |
( |
| ) |
|
|
overrideprotectedvirtual |
◆ AutoDetectMidiController
| friend class AutoDetectMidiController |
|
friend |
◆ gui::ControllerConnectionDialog
◆ m_lastValue
| float lmms::MidiController::m_lastValue |
|
protected |
◆ m_midiPort
| MidiPort lmms::MidiController::m_midiPort |
|
protected |
◆ m_previousValue
| float lmms::MidiController::m_previousValue |
|
protected |
◆ NONE
| int lmms::MidiController::NONE = -1 |
|
staticconstexpr |
The documentation for this class was generated from the following files: